A former student of the École normale supérieure and holder of a PhD in economics from the EHESS, Thomas Breda has dedicated his research to the study of collective bargaining, discrimination, and inequalities in the labor market. After completing a postdoctoral fellowship at the London School of Economics and Political Science, he joined Paris School of Economics in 2013 as a researcher at the CNRS and economist at the Institut des politiques publiques. He has been Director of the IPP’s Labor Program since 2015.
